Etymology[edit]

From Proto-Iranian *hárwah, from Proto-Indo-Iranian *sárwas (whole, all, entire), from Proto-Indo-European *sólh₂wos, from *solh₂- (whole). Cognate with Sanskrit सर्व (sárva), Old Persian 𐏃𐎽𐎺 (h-ru-v /⁠haruva⁠/) (whence Persian هر (har)), Ancient Greek ὅλος (hólos, whole), Latin sollus.

Adjective[edit]

𐬵𐬀𐬎𐬭𐬎𐬎𐬀 (hauruua)

  1. whole, entire
